What's The Definition Of Peddlery?Synonyms | Synonyms for Peddlery: Related Terms | Find terms related to Peddlery: See Also | Peddlery In Webster's Dictionary \Ped"dler*y\, n. [Written also pedlary and pedlery.]
1. The trade, or the goods, of a peddler; hawking; small
retail business, like that of a peddler.
2. Trifling; trickery. [Obs.] ``Look . . . into these their
deceitful peddleries.'' --Milton.
